Output d51ec75d204f33a3849cc53fbc7714f6844b06b2d6b34d33c539d42e1622dd46:1

value
2883508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ea877038609aba1941a4d9a19fc48c349681082e OP_EQUAL
address
3P56HrWBM44inaWEFzvfkNRBtCpvaknWZd
transaction
d51ec75d204f33a3849cc53fbc7714f6844b06b2d6b34d33c539d42e1622dd46
spent
true